Excel计算数据库技巧揭秘,如何快速提升数据处理效率?
要通过Excel计算数据库,核心步骤主要包括:1、数据导入与连接;2、数据透视表与公式分析;3、自动化与可视化操作;4、集成零代码平台简道云实现高级数据库管理。其中,“数据导入与连接”是关键,用户可以利用Excel内置的数据连接工具(如Power Query)将外部数据库(如SQL Server、MySQL等)的数据实时接入Excel,实现动态更新和分析。这大大简化了原本繁杂的数据搬运流程,不仅提升了工作效率,还确保了数据的一致性和准确性。此外,结合零代码开发平台,如简道云(官网:https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c; ),可进一步拓展功能,实现更复杂的业务流程自动化和多源数据协同,为企业数字化转型提供有力支撑。
《如何通过excel计算数据库》
一、EXCEL与数据库的集成方式
在现代办公环境中,Excel不仅仅是表格处理工具,更成为企业进行数据库管理和分析的重要入口。实现Excel与数据库的集成主要有以下几种方式:
| 集成方式 | 适用场景 | 优点 | 缺点 |
|---|---|---|---|
| 直接导入/导出CSV文件 | 简单小型数据迁移 | 操作简便,无需配置 | 不支持实时同步,易丢失变更 |
| ODBC/ADO.NET连接 | 大型或实时数据库访问 | 高效同步,支持自动刷新 | 配置较复杂,对权限要求高 |
| Power Query/Power BI | 高级数据处理及分析 | 自动化强,支持多源融合 | 需要部分学习成本 |
| API对接 | 云端或自定义系统集成 | 灵活扩展,可自动定时抓取 | 技术门槛较高 |
详细解释
最常用的是通过ODBC(开放式数据库连接)或者Power Query将SQL Server、Oracle、MySQL等主流关系型数据库的数据直接拉取到Excel。只需配置一次后,每次打开Excel就能获取最新的数据更新,非常适合日常报表和经营决策。
二、EXCEL实现数据库计算的主流方法
根据实际需求,通过Excel进行数据库计算通常包括以下几个步骤:
- 数据库连接配置
- 数据抓取导入
- 数据清洗和预处理
- 使用公式或函数进行计算
- 利用透视表做多维度统计分析
步骤说明
- 1)配置ODBC/ADO.NET连接
- 安装相应驱动程序;
- 在“数据”选项卡下选择“从其他来源获取数据”,按提示输入服务器地址及账号;
- 测试连通性并保存设置。
- 2)抓取所需表格或视图
- 按业务需求选择需要同步的字段和记录范围;
- 支持定时刷新,比如每小时/每天自动拉新。
- 3)清洗预处理
- 利用Power Query进行去重、筛选或格式转换;
- 填充缺失值,为后续统计做好准备。
- 4)公式与函数运算
- 常见如SUMIF/SUMIFS/VLOOKUP/XLOOKUP/COUNTIF等,用于分组汇总或条件筛查;
- 可嵌套自定义函数,提高灵活性。
- 5)透视表分析
- 拖拽字段快速生成交叉报表、多维度比较;
- 支持图形展示,如柱状图、折线图等。
三、高阶实践:零代码平台助力——以简道云为例
随着企业数字化进程加快,仅靠传统Excel难以满足复杂业务场景需求。零代码开发平台,例如简道云,可以极大提升效率:
| 平台名称 | 功能亮点 | 与EXCEL集成优势 |
|---|---|---|
| 简道云 | 表单建模、多源联动、流程审批 | 无需编程,拖拉拽设计复杂系统 |
| Power Apps | 企业应用搭建 | 与Office365生态无缝协作 |
案例解析
用户可在简道云(官网:https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c; )新建业务应用,通过在线表单收集各部门提交的数据,再设置自动同步到企业现有MySQL/PostgreSQL等专业数据库。与此同时,还可嵌入自定义规则,实现审批流转和智能提醒,大幅减少人工操作错误,并保证信息安全合规。这些功能均通过拖拽控件完成,“零代码”让非IT人员也能参与系统搭建。
四、多种方案对比及使用建议
不同方案各具优劣,应结合实际业务体量和技术能力选择:
- 小微企业推荐:直接利用EXCEL的外部数据源功能+CSV迁移。
- 成长型公司推荐:采用ODBC+Power Query,实现半自动化更新与清洗。
- 中大型集团推荐:引入零代码平台(如简道云),统一管理多部门、多系统间的数据交互。
对比汇总表
| 场景 | 工具组合 | 实现难度 | 成本投入 |
|---|---|---|---|
| 小微企业 | EXCEL+CSV | ★ | 极低 |
| 成长型公司 | EXCEL+ODBC+Power Query | ★★ | 较低 |
| 大型集团 | 零代码平台+专业DBMS | ★★★ | 中高 |
五、安全性与性能优化建议
在实际操作中,应注意以下几点,以保障系统稳定运行并防止信息泄露:
- 权限控制:限制EXCEL访问敏感库的账号权限,仅授予只读权限。
- 定期备份:无论是本地还是云端,应设立定期备份策略防止误删。
- 加密传输:启用SSL/TLS协议保护传输链路安全。
- 性能调优:
- 谨慎选择查询字段,避免全量拉取大批量历史记录;
- 借助索引优化查询速度;
- 合理分批同步,减轻服务器压力。
六、常见问题答疑及案例分享
常见问题
-
Q1: Excel无法实时刷新外部库怎么办? A: 优先检查网络连通性,然后排查ODBC驱动版本兼容问题,并尝试重设连接参数。
-
Q2: 如何防止误操作带来全量删除风险? A: 建议只赋予最低限度的读取权限,并关闭写操作接口。
案例分享
某制造业客户采用“EXCEL + Power Query + 简道云”三位一体方案,将生产线采集到的数据经由简道云归集,再由总部财务部门通过Excel读取并深度分析,实现了供应链成本下降15%、报表制作周期缩短60%的显著效果。
七、结论与行动建议
综上所述,通过合理利用Excel强大的外部数据链接能力以及借助如简道云这样的零代码开发平台,不仅可以高效实现对企业级数据库的访问和计算,更能够推动管理流程升级和数字化转型进程。建议用户根据自身需求评估最佳实施路径——初步可以尝试使用简单的数据导入,再逐步升级到自动同步甚至全流程无纸化办公。如果希望进一步提升效率,不妨注册体验【简道云零代码开发平台】(https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c; ),打造属于自己的智能业务系统。
最后推荐:100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ac
精品问答:
如何通过Excel连接和计算数据库中的数据?
我想知道如何使用Excel直接连接数据库,并在Excel中计算和分析数据库中的数据,能不能详细说说具体步骤和方法?
通过Excel连接数据库,通常使用“数据”选项卡中的“从数据库导入”功能,支持多种数据库类型如SQL Server、MySQL等。连接成功后,可以利用Excel的公式和数据透视表对导入的数据进行计算和分析。例如,导入销售数据库后,用SUMIF函数统计不同地区的销售额。此方法无需编写复杂代码,提高了数据库数据处理效率。
Excel中有哪些常用函数适合对数据库导入的数据进行计算?
我经常将数据库中的数据导入到Excel,但不清楚哪些函数最适合用来快速进行汇总、筛选和统计,希望了解一些实用的函数及案例。
常用的Excel函数包括SUMIFS、COUNTIFS、VLOOKUP、INDEX-MATCH等。比如,用SUMIFS可以根据多个条件对导入的数据进行求和;VLOOKUP结合数据库主键快速匹配相关信息。举例来说,从客户订单表中筛选2023年特定产品销量,用SUMIFS实现条件求和,处理效率提升30%以上。
如何利用Excel的数据透视表功能高效分析从数据库提取的大量数据?
我听说数据透视表是分析大量数据的利器,但不清楚它具体怎么应用于从数据库提取出来的数据上,有什么优势吗?
数据透视表是一种强大的工具,可以快速对从数据库导出的海量信息进行分组汇总。例如,将销售订单按地区和月份分类统计,实现动态交叉分析。相比手动筛选,数据透视表能节省70%的分析时间,并且支持拖拽字段调整视角,非常适合非专业人员操作。
如何保证通过Excel计算时的数据库数据实时性与准确性?
我担心从数据库导入到Excel的数据不是最新的或存在误差,有没有办法确保每次计算基于最新且准确的数据?
为了保证实时性,可以设置Excel中的“刷新所有”功能,使得每次打开文件或点击刷新按钮时自动重新连接并拉取最新数据。同时,确保查询语句正确过滤无效记录,并定期验证关键字段一致性。例如,通过设置自动刷新频率,每日更新销量报表,减少因过时数据导致决策失误的风险超过85%。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/85173/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。